Reliance Securities : How to update with your aadhar ?

Posted on November 3, 2017November 4, 2017 by Stocks On Fire

To update aadhar number with your Reliance Securities (RSEC) Stock Trading Account follow the below steps:

Open https://tick.rsec.co.in/ and login with your Trading Account credentials.

STEP 1 : Select Your Profile Icon on the top right Corner.

STEP 2 : Select the My Profile menu.

Reliance Securities Trading Account update Aadhar

 

STEP 3 : When the Profile window opens up, Scroll down and Select Update Aadhar No. menu.

Reliance Securities Trading Account update Aadhar

STEP 4 : Enter your Aadhar Number.

STEP 5 : Tick the I agree button and then Click the “Send OTP” button.

Reliance Securities Trading Account update Aadhar Number

 

STEP 6 : After you receive the OTP to your mobile, enter it in this new text box and click “Verify OTP”

Reliance Securities Trading Account update Aadhar Number

If you have followed the above steps correctly, you will receive the following pop up message on your browser. Good job. Your Aadhar Number is now linked with your Trading Account with Reliance Securities.
